Castle Drive is in Bakewell and in Derbyshire Dales district. DE45 1AS is located in the Bakewell elect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Derbyshire Dales. This postcode has been in use since 1992-08-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ding DE45 1AS,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 54.8%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Partnership Status

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.

In the immediate vicinity of DE45 1AS there is a very large concentration of residents that are married - 61.5% of the resident population. In contrast, the average marriage rate across the census is about 44%.

Areas with a high percentage of married residents are typically suburban neighborhoods, towns with good schools and family-friendly amenities, and regions with affordable, spacious housing options. Additionally, such areas can be popular among retirees.

Education and Qualifications

During the 2021 census, the educational qualifications of residents across the UK were as follows: 18.2% had no qualifications, 9.6% had 1-4 GCSEs, 13.4% had 5 or more GCSEs and 1-2 A/AS Levels, 16.9% had 2 or more A Levels, 33.8% held a degree (or equivalent), and 5.4% had completed an apprenticeship.

In the area around DE45 1AS this area, 7.4% of residents have no qualifications. This is significantly lower than the UK average of 18.2%. This area stands out for its high percentage of residents with higher education degree or similar. The UK average is 33.8%, while in this area it is 51.7%.

Safety

Is Castle Drive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Castle Drive was 61.5 per 1,000 residents, which is 13.2% lower than the Bakewell average. The most reported crime type was Burglary.

Castle Drive has the 18th highest crime rate of 68 local areas in Bakewell and the 65th highest crime rate of 248 local areas in Derbyshire Dales .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 20.5 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has risen by about 37.1%.

Employment

DE45 1AS area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 0%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.

The percentage of retired residents living in DE45 1AS area is much higher than the country's average. According to Census 2011, 60% residents of this area were retired, while the average in the UK was 14%.
